Beyond theoretical demonstrations, business management software are powerfully deployed in a diverse array of real-world scenarios. For illustration, a medium-sized retail outlet might employ inventory tracking features to improve stock levels and minimize waste. Larger manufacturing organizations often implement integrated ERP solutions to simplify workflows across departments, including finance, manufacturing, and shipping. Additionally, user relationship management tools are commonly used by sales teams to nurture leads and enhance client happiness. These cases highlight the tangible advantages of using robust company management platforms.
Business Operations Software: Practical Applications & Examples
Business operational platforms offer a extensive suite of practical uses for enhancing business processes. For example, a assembly firm might utilize specialized software to manage inventory amounts, schedule production cycles, and streamline supply chain. Similarly, a consulting company could leverage such tools to process client intake, manage project timelines, and produce precise billing records. Ultimately, these solutions help businesses to increase productivity, reduce overhead, and improve overall output. Examples include Oracle for large-scale resource allocation and Trello for project collaboration.
